What will I learn?
This Control and Regulation Course provides practical skills for designing, tuning, and troubleshooting temperature control in jacketed mixing tanks. You will learn thermodynamics, heat transfer, sensors, actuators, disturbance handling, process modeling, cascade and split-range loops, PID tuning methods, PLC implementation, and validation of stable, high-performance operations on real systems.

Develop skills
- Model thermal tanks: build fast first-order temperature control models.
- Tune PID loops: apply Ziegler–Nichols, Cohen–Coon, and IMC in practice.
- Design robust loops: cascade, split-range, and feedforward for disturbances.
- Implement PLC control: configure PID blocks, scaling, alarms, and interlocks.
- Validate performance: analyze stability, KPIs, and optimize loop robustness.
